In vitro and in vivo near-infrared photothermal therapy of cancer using polypyrrole organic nanoparticles.

AuthorsKai Yang, Huan Xu, Liang Cheng, Chunyang Sun, Jun Wang, Zhuang Liu
JournalAdvanced materials (Deerfield Beach, Fla.) (Adv Mater) Vol. 24 Issue 41 Pg. 5586-92 (Nov 02 2012) ISSN: 1521-4095 [Electronic] Germany
PMID22907876 (Publication Type: Journal Article, Research Support, Non-U.S. Gov't)
